- [ ] Step 7: Archive cold storage buckets (Glacierline tier). Confirm both ceremony witnesses are present, verify bucket manifests match the Oxbow ledger, then seal the archive key shares. Plugin authors may observe but not handle shares. Once sealed, the archive index itself is encrypted and can only be reopened with the passphrase below.

vault phrase of badup-hahig = tamael-aldael-kelmir-istael-fenok-istwyn-tamius-jorath-oliion

Fenwick Systems alleges our Lattice module exceeds the scope of the 2021 license covering the Orvane toolkit. Their counsel sent a second demand letter last month. Exposure estimate: mid six figures plus renegotiated royalties. Our position: usage falls within the derivative-works clause; outside counsel agrees but flags ambiguity in Section 4. Options: settle, renegotiate, or litigate. Settlement talks tentatively set for early next quarter. Resolution affects the Lattice roadmap. The confidential note on business plans follows below.

internal memo for hahaf-kahof: Only 39 of the 428 pilot accounts renewed Sorion, so a churn review is set for April 12. Praokix Freight is in early talks to buy Queniusox Group for about $145.8 million.

UserSplit Cutover Drift: the extracted account service and the legacy Marigold monolith user module are reporting divergent record counts during dual-write. This fires when drift exceeds 0.5% over 15 minutes. New team members should not replay writes manually. Reconciliation steps and the rollback procedure are documented on the internal page.

wiki page, tajog-fafog: https://gitlab.paliqsys.corp/dash/display/job/853dd6fcbf54